Most tank water heaters last 8 to 12 years. Consider replacement when your unit is over 10 years old, produces rusty or discolored water, makes rumbling or popping noises, or requires frequent repairs. To prevent frozen pipes in Heartland, insulate exposed pipes in unheated areas like garages, crawl spaces, and attics. Keep cabinet doors under sinks open during cold snaps. Let faucets drip slightly during freezing temperatures. If a pipe does freeze, call Magnet Plumbing immediately rather than attempting to thaw it yourself to avoid a burst.
Signs of a slab leak in Heartland homes include unexplained increases in your water bill, warm or wet spots on the floor, the sound of running water when all fixtures are off, cracks in the foundation or walls, and low water pressure. If you notice these symptoms, call a plumber for professional slab leak detection before the damage worsens.

Your main water shutoff valve in Heartland is typically located near the water meter, near the front foundation, or in the basement or utility room. Turn the valve clockwise to close it.
